Question
which of the following represents a covalent molecule?
select all that apply
a co₂
b cl₂
c o₂
d he
Brief Explanations
- For \(CO_2\): Carbon and oxygen are non - metals. They share electrons to form covalent bonds, so \(CO_2\) is a covalent molecule.
- For \(Cl_2\): Chlorine atoms (non - metals) share electrons between them. The bond in \(Cl_2\) is covalent, and it is a covalent molecule.
- For \(O_2\): Oxygen atoms (non - metals) share electrons. The \(O = O\) bond is covalent, and \(O_2\) is a covalent molecule.
- For \(He\): Helium is a noble gas. It exists as single atoms (not molecules with covalent bonds) as it has a full valence shell and does not form covalent bonds under normal conditions.
